European Tech Recruit's client, a global leader in semiconductor innovation, is seeking a Research Engineer to bridge research and implementation in AI-enabled computing.

You will work on LLMs, RL, optimisation, and generative AI, building prototypes and supporting research initiatives.

Collaborating with leading AI experts, you will develop and maintain research infrastructure, experiment pipelines, and internal tooling while analysing results for reports and documentation.
